Some Pacific Faunal Province graptolites from the Ordovician of northern Yukon, Canada

1977 ◽  
Vol 14 (8) ◽  
pp. 1946-1952 ◽  
Author(s):  
A. C. Lenz

Tylograptus, Sinograptus, Pterograptus, Syndyograptus, and Reteograptus pulcherrimus are described from northern Yukon. The last three taxa are recognized for the first time in northern Canada. Reteograptus pulcherrimus occurs in Ashgillian age beds, the remainder in Llanvirnian and Llandeilian beds. All taxa are found in regions bordering the present Pacific or Arctic Oceans; however, Pterograptus also occurs in the Baltic region, and Syndyograptus is found in the Appalachian region.

AbstractResults of inventory of lichen-forming, lichenicolous and allied saprobic fungi from the Čepkeliai State Nature Reserve are presented. From this largest in Lithuania mire complex, altogether 207 species (of these, 180 species of lichens, 22 lichenicolous and 5 non-lichenized saprobic fungi) are reported. One lichenized – Fuscidea praeruptorum and two lichenicolous species – Sphaerellothecium cladoniae and Taeniolella cladinicola are reported for the first time in Lithuania. Two lichenicolous fungi – Endococcus tricolorans and Nectriopsis cariosae are reported for the first time in the Baltic region. Parmelia and Pseudevernia are reported as new host genera for Endococcus tricolorans.

The pseudoscorpion Chernes similis (Beier, 1932) is reported from the Baltic region for the first time. The new record from Lithuania is based on a single male specimen found in a mould growing in a hollow of a Tilia L. tree in the Botanical Garden of Vilnius University. This finding represents the northernmost record of C. similis. With the new record of C. similis, nine pseudoscorpion species, belonging to six genera and three families, are currently known from Lithuania.

AbstractA conodont-graptolite biostratigraphic study was carried out on the top strata of the San Juan, Las Chacritas and Las Aguaditas formations in the La Trampa Range, Precordillera of San Juan in western Argentina. Significant conodont records in the San Juan and Las Chacritas formations allow for the recognition of the Yangtzeplacognathus crassus, Eoplacognathus pseudoplanus (Microzarkodina hagetiana and M. ozarkodella subzones) and Eoplacognathus suecicus zones of Darriwilian age. Index species and co-occurrences of graptolites and conodonts were recorded in the Las Aguaditas Formation allowing the identification of the Nemagraptus gracilis and the Pygodus anserinus zones, which represent the Sandbian Stage. These data indicate a hiatus between the Las Chacritas and the Las Aguaditas formations, corresponding to the Pygodus serra Zone and the Pterograptus elegans and Hustedograptus teretiusculus zones (upper Darriwilian). A total of 7287 identifiable conodont elements were recorded from the study section. The species frequency registered for each zone shows that Periodon and Paroistodus are the most abundant taxa, which are indicative of open marine environments. The records of particular conodont taxa, such as Histiodella, Periodon, Microzarkodina, Eoplacognathus and Baltoniodus, allow a precise global correlation with other regions such as south-central China, Baltoscandia, North America, Great Britain, Southern Australia and New Zealand. The graptolite fauna identified here are recognized worldwide in equivalent strata in the Baltic region, Great Britain, North America, China, southern Australia and New Zealand. The presence of graptolites in the ribbon limestones of the Las Chacritas Formation is documented for the first time.

Objectives The aim of this study was to evaluate whether haemotropic Mycoplasma species are detected in pet cats in Latvia, to perform a phylogenetic analysis of the detected pathogens and to report a clinical case of feline infectious anaemia. Methods Peripheral blood samples (n = 125) from pet cats were submitted; 99 samples were adequate to test for the presence of Mycoplasma species DNA by nested PCR. A clinical case was added in the later stages of the study. Positive isolates were subjected to phylogenetic analysis. Results The prevalence of ‘ Candidatus Mycoplasma haemominutum’ was 15% (n = 15/99), that of Mycoplasma haemofelis was 5% (5/99) and that of ‘ Candidatus Mycoplasma turicensis’ was 2% (n = 2/99). Cases of coinfection included ‘ Candidatus M haemominutum’ + M haemofelis (4%; n = 4/99) and ‘ Candidatus M haemominutum’ + ‘ Candidatus M turicensis’ (1%; n = 1/99). This is the first published report of M haemofelis infection in the Baltic states. Two different ‘ Candidatus M turicensis’ isolates were discovered after phylogenetic analysis. Conclusions and relevance This report is the first of an autochthonous feline infectious anaemia case in the Baltic region. The prevalence of Mycoplasma species was similar to that in other northern European countries. Phylogenetic analysis revealed variability of the isolates; one of the ‘ Candidatus M turicensis’ genotypes was detected for the first time in Europe.

The paper characterizes the 3 associations comprising plant communities with Sphagnum rubellum in the south-eastern part of the Baltic region. The new syntaxa differ from each other both in their floristic characters and the pronounced affinity to definite regional mire types and particular habitats. The ass. Drosero-Sphagnetum rubelli is typical of the relatively most thorough ranges. It is observed from the Kaliningrad region to the Karelian Isthmus and, according to the published reference, occurs even throughout the whole area around the Baltic Sea. Its most typical habitat is that of margins of mire lakes and pools. The ass. Eriophoro-Sphagnetum rubelli occurs in central plateaus of convex plateau-like bogs, typical of the areas adjacent to the Baltic Sea coast. It occupies extended flat mire ecotopes with the water level 0.2–0.25 m deep. The ass. Empetro-Sphagnetum rubelli is characteristic of the retrogressive complex in the convex bogs of the East-Baltic Province. It is mostly observed along the coast of the Gulf of Finland. Its stands are rather dynamic and unstable in both space and time. The presence of communities comprised by these 3 associations is an important vegetation character of the series of regional mire types. Assuming an association level of the respective syntaxa seems rational for the purposes of adequate reflection of plant cover diversity.

The article deals with statistics on the development of Bicycle roads in Russia and in the world, as well as design methods for a specific section of the connection of Bicycle routes in St. Petersburg. The article discusses the experience of using and entering bike paths based on the experience of Finland, as well as the types of bike paths and infrastructure features for metropolises. A model for creating a bike path by partially narrowing the roadway, graphical functions, and analytical information are provided. Practical examples of changing the infrastructure for bike paths are given. Keywords: bike path, traffic volume, design the roadway, lane width.

The total mass of columnar water vapour (precipitable water, W) is an important parameter of atmospheric thermodynamic and radiative models. In this work more than 60 000 radiosonde observations from 17 aerological stations in the Baltic region over 14 years, 1989–2002, were used to examine the variability of precipitable water. A table of monthly and annual means of W for the stations is given. Seasonal means of W are expressed as linear functions of the geographical latitude degree. A linear formula is also derived for parametrisation of precipitable water as a function of two parameters – geographical latitude and surface water vapour pressure.

Abstract Background Several recent studies in the Baltic region have found extended spectrum of pathogenic variants (PV) of the BRCA1/2 genes. The aim of current study is to analyze the spectrum of the BRCA1/2 PV in population of Latvia and to compare common PV between populations of the Baltic region. Methods We present a cohort of 9543 unrelated individuals including ones with cancer and unaffected individuals from population of Latvia, who were tested for three most common BRCA1 founder PV. In second line testing, 164 founder negative high-risk individuals were tested for PV of the BRCA1/2 using next generation sequencing (NGS). Local spectrum of the BRCA1/2 PV was compared with the Baltic region by performing a literature review. Results Founder PV c.5266dupC, c.4035delA or c.181 T > G was detected in 369/9543 (3.9%) cases. Other BRCA1/2 PV were found in 44/164 (26.8%) of NGS cases. Four recurrent BRCA1 variants c.5117G > A (p.Gly1706Glu), c.4675G > A (p.Glu1559Lys), c.5503C > T (p.Arg1835*) and c.1961delA (p.Lys654fs) were detected in 18/44 (41.0%), 5/44 (11.4%), 2/44 (4.5%) and 2/44 (4.5%) cases respectively. Additionally, 11 BRCA1 PV and six BRCA2 PV were each found in single family. Conclusions By combining three studies by our group of the same cohort in Latvia, frequency of the BRCA1/2 PV for unselected breast and ovarian cancer cases is 241/5060 (4.8%) and 162/1067 (15.2%) respectively. The frequency of three “historical” founder PV is up to 87.0% (369/424). Other non-founder PV contribute to at least 13.0% (55/424) and this proportion probably will rise by increasing numbers of the BRCA1/2 sequencing. In relative numbers, c.5117G > A is currently the third most frequent PV of the BRCA1 in population of Latvia, overcoming previously known third most common founder variant c.181 T > G. In addition to three BRCA1 founder PV, a total of five recurrent BRCA1 and two recurrent BRCA2 PV have been reported in population of Latvia so far. Many of the BRCA1/2 PV reported in Latvia are shared among other populations of the Baltic region.
